Angola Company Sold in $48M Deal

CLEVELAND (WOWO): An Steuben County  company has been sold.

ParkOhio announced today it has acquired Angola's Autoform Tool and Manufacturing.

The company builds fuel lines for cars and trucks.

The deal is worth more than $48 million dollars. The company was founded in 1996.
